What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as?

The average price of all fl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
If you are looking for a flight deal from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as, look for departures on Tuesdays and avoid leaving on a Friday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from Las Vegas, Wednesday is the cheapest day to fly and Monday is the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as is January, where tickets cost $170 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are July and June, where the average cost of tickets is $309 and $302 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as, you should book around 1 week before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 14 days before departure.

Which airlines fly most frequently between Chicago O'Hare Airport and Las Vegas?

The airlines most regularly connecting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as are United Airlines (11 flights per day), American Airlines (9 flights per day), and Southwest (4 flights per day).

Which airlines fly non-stop between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port and Las Vegas?

Airline and price data is aggregated from results in KAYAK’s search results from the last 2 weeks for fl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as.
There are 4 airlines that fly nonstop from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as. They are: American Airlines, Southwest, Spirit Airlines and United Airlines. The cheapest price of all airlines flying this route was found with Spirit Airlines at $91 for a one-way flight. On average, the best prices for this route can be found at Spirit Airlines.

How many flights are there between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port and Las Vegas per day?

Each day, there are between 26 and 29 nonstop flights that take off from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port and land in Las Vegas, with an average flight time of 4h 09m. The most common departure time is 9:00 am and most flights take off in the morning. Each week, there are 190 flights. The most frequent day of departure is Sunday, when 15% of all weekly flights depart. The fewest flights depart on a Saturday.

Which cabin class options are there for flights between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port and Las Vegas?

The average price of flights for each cabin class for the route found by users searching on KAYAK over the last 2 weeks.
There are 4 cabin class options for the route. These are First, Business, Economy and Prem Economy. Perform a search on KAYAK to find the latest prices and availability for all cabin fares, which differ across airlines.

How long does a flight from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as take?

Direct flights cover the 1,510 miles separating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as in about 4h 00m.

What’s the earliest departure time from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as?

Early birds can take the earliest fl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port at 5:45 am and will be landing in Las Vegas at 7:45 am.

What’s the latest departure time from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as?

If you prefer to fly at night, the latest fl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Las Vegas jets off at 11:58 pm and lands at 2:03 am.

FAQs for booking Chicago O'Hare Airport to Las Vegas flights

  • Are there hotels on site at McCarran International Airport (LAS)?

    McCarran International Airport (LAS) sits near a wide range of accommodation options, making it an ideal facility for those arriving late at night. Homewood Suites by Hilton Las Vegas Airport and The Carriage House are recommended. Visitors at these properties enjoy courtesy airport transportation.

  • How can I move between the terminals at Chicago O’Hare International Airport (ORD)?

    Chicago O’Hare International Airport (ORD) operates four terminals. Terminal 5 serves international flights, while Terminals 1, 2, and 3 are reserved for local departures and arrivals. Movement between the terminals is via courtesy shuttles, which depart every 10min. Also, the Airport Transit System connects the domestic and international terminals.

  • Can I rent a car upon arrival at McCarran International Airport (LAS)?

    Yes. With several car rental agencies operating at LAS, you can quickly get a car to tour the city. Some famous brands running their counters here include Hertz, Avis, Enterprise, and Budget. Remember that the pickup location is off site from the airport, located at McCarran Rent-A-Car Center. Most agencies provide complimentary transport to the garage.

  • Is there a spa at Las Vegas McCarran International Airport (LAS)?

    Suppose you are weary after your trip from ORD; you will find a couple of spas at LAS where you can relax and seek self-indulgence. XpresSpa is a popular outlet for its services, such as manicures, pedicures, facials, and deep-tissue massages. This amenity is located in Terminal 1, D Gates, near Gate D32.

  • Are there any services for disabled passengers at LAS upon their arrival?

    If you have limited mobility, bear in mind that LAS is fully ADA-compliant. TDD phones are available for those with hearing challenges, while trained personnel are available to offer cab-to-terminal services. In addition, the property allows the use of a wheelchair, especially in high-traffic areas like restrooms.

  • Which nearby cities can I get to from McCarran International Airport?

    Aside from Las Vegas, McCarran International Airport (LAS) serves other nearby towns. For instance, Lake Mead National Recreation Area, Boulder City, Nelson, and Primm are less than an hour’s drive from here. Moreover, Sandy Mill, Logandale, Sandy Valley, and Moapa Valley are about an hour away.

  • What accessible services are provided at the O’Hare Airport?

    ORD has several accessible services for people with disabilities. To cater to the needs of hearing-impaired travelers, the airport has a TDD phone service and visual paging service. The airport also has family care restrooms that are fitted with adult changing tables. For wheelchair users, the airport requires you to make arrangements with your airline.

  • What parking options are available at O’Hare?

    O’Hare International Airport offers a variety of parking options to meet your needs that range from international and valet to daily and hourly parking. You will also find long-term and economy parking. Parking fees are made to the cashier upon exiting the lots and range from approximately $3 for hourly parking to around $42 for daily parking.

  • How will I get from McCarran to my hotel?

    There are several transport options to choose from. The most reliable and common option is the airport shuttle. You can also opt for shared rides or rent a car. The McCarran Rent-A-Car facility is located roughly 3 miles south of the airport. You can book your ride in advance to avoid wasting time at the airport. The center is open 24/7, 365 days a year.

  • Are there any attractions at McCarran International Airport?

    McCarran has a few attractions that are worth your time and attention. You can wander through the Aviation Museum or view the Airport Art. Alternatively, check out the Voices of Vegas: An LAS Playlist or admire the #SpottedAtLAS Virtual Photo Gallery. You will find that there is plenty to do to keep you occupied before your flight.

Top tips for finding a cheap flight from ORD to Las Vegas

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$115 or less one-way and $223 or less round-trip.
  • Passengers flying aboard United Airlines from Chicago to Las Vegas will find it convenient that the carrier operates a hub at Chicago O’Hare International Airport (ORD). You will depart via Terminal 1 at ORD on your way to Las Vegas. Besides the fast-lane service at the security counter, you will find many nonstop flight options from ORD to McCarran International Airport (LAS).
  • Most airlines operating between ORD and LAS, including United Airlines, allow travelers to bring their four-legged friends, like cats and dogs, into the cabin. Remember to check with the airline regarding specific requirements, such as medical documentation and vaccine certificates, before boarding. Usually, the management will require that you lock your pet in a kennel or pet carrier.
  • Spirit and Southwest Airlines are two popular carriers that make one-stop journeys between ORD and LAS. Whereas Spirit Airlines travels to Las Vegas via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W), Southwest Airlines makes a layover at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port (PHX) before arriving in Las Vegas. Consider these flights if you are on a tight budget.
  • O’Hare International Airport (ORD) is located roughly 14 miles northwest of Chicago, Illinois. The airport is accessible from downtown via the CTA Blue Line. The trains operate at intervals of around 1h 30min and drop passengers at Terminal 1, 2, 3, and 5. The bus service is available 24h and the fare is around $5.
  • McCarran International Airport (LAS) serves as the main public airport within the Las Vegas area. Located about 5 miles from downtown Las Vegas, the airport serves as a central point for passengers. The Green Line, Red Line, and Blue Line airport trams operate within the airport and move passengers across terminals and gates.
  • O’Hare offers travelers the space to relax and enjoy a meal or a drink. The airport lounges offer a comfortable and tranquil environment for all passengers. Usually, you can pay at the door to access particular lounges while others allow you to pay for a day pass. Lounges available at ORD are Centurion Lounge, the Delta Sky Club, and United Club.
  • If you will be traveling with kids, you can keep them engaged before your flight at the kids’ play area at ORD. The aviation-themed park allows them to be imaginative as they interact with the mock jet engine and the mini control tower.
  • If you need to top up your wallet, there are several ATM locations within O’Hare International Airport. The ATM service is available in all public areas.
